How AI Changes Fabric Recommendation Logic
Ask Mike's core innovation lies in moving beyond traditional e-commerce keyword search. Previously, consumers or buyers had to input precise terms like "cotton print fabric" or "linen blend" to get exact matches. Now, using natural language processing and machine learning, Ask Mike understands vague requests such as "I need a breathable fabric for summer cushions" and offers personalized suggestions.
This capability relies on deep linking between product attributes (fiber content, weight, weave, colorfastness) and user intent. For the textile industry, this means upstream SKU management may shift—from waiting to be found by keywords to actively matching potential demand.
Direct Impact on Home Textile and Fabric Procurement
Michaels' customer base includes DIY enthusiasts, small home textile brands, and professional crafters. Ask Mike first lowers the barrier for non-professional users. A home sewer who once missed suitable fabric due to unfamiliarity with terms like "high thread count" can now receive AI recommendations for "curtain fabric with good drape and fade resistance."
For professional buyers, efficiency gains are more pronounced. Traditional B2B fabric procurement involves sampling, color card comparison, and specification confirmation—time-consuming steps. An AI assistant that integrates order history and user feedback can filter suppliers by cost, delivery time, and performance within seconds.
Industry Trend: AI Diffusion from Apparel to Home
Previous AI applications in textiles focused on apparel design (e.g., trend forecasting) and manufacturing (e.g., defect detection). Ask Mike marks AI's expansion into the retail segment of home textiles, aligning with the global home textile market's growth—valued at over $130 billion in 2023, with rising online penetration.
For Chinese textile clusters like Nantong (home textiles) and Shaoxing (curtain fabrics), this means overseas retail tech changes may ripple upstream. If AI assistants significantly boost conversion, brands will prefer suppliers offering structured, machine-readable product data over traditional catalogs or vague descriptions.
Practical Advice
For Fabric Suppliers - Optimize product data tags: Label each fabric with machine-readable fields including composition, weight, width, application scenarios (curtains, cushions), and care instructions to be easily indexed by AI. - Build digital sample libraries: Convert physical samples into high-resolution images with color codes, paired with user reviews, to train AI recommendation models.
For Home Textile Buyers - Test AI tool boundaries: Use Ask Mike on platforms like Michaels to compare its recommendations with manual selection, assessing time and cost savings. - Monitor data feedback: Collect frequently recommended fabric attributes from AI, and adjust procurement lists to prioritize those algorithm-favored categories.
